This paper describes the advancement of hot wire or hot filament CVD methods of diamond synthesis through the use high velocity gas flow activation by multiple collisions with a lengthy hot surface instead of activation by single collisions with hot wires. The study presents results on deposition of diamond structures from high‐velocity flows of carbon‐containing a gas mixture activated by hot surfaces. Important problems were solved by creation of the reactor using a spiral of heat‐resistant material, inserted into the chamber with an inlet nozzle.
